When you enable the Health Cloud Lightning Experience Console, your users can access the console using the App Launcher. To turn on the Console, add the app to your org and assign users. Users with Health Cloud Standard or Health Cloud Admin permission sets can access the Health Cloud - Lightning Console app. You need the Health Cloud Admin permission set to access the Health Cloud - Lightning Admin app.

The Health Cloud console in Salesforce Classic is still here, and it’s easy for Lightning Experience users to move between the old and the new. So even if Lightning Experience isn’t a perfect fit yet, you and your users can try it on for size without losing out.

Create the Health Cloud - Lightning Console App

checklist item Use the App Manager to create a Lightning console app and name it Health Cloud - Lightning Console.

checklist item Set the app’s primary color, give it a logo, and add a description.

checklist item Add items to your app’s utility bar, select the items you want to appear in the app, and assign it to user profiles.

Create the Patient Console Record Page

checklist item In the Lightning App Builder, create a record page named Patient Console and select the Account object.

checklist item Select the three-column page template.

checklist item Drag the Patient Detail for Health Cloud component into the left column.

checklist item Customize the other two columns by dragging other components onto the page.

checklist item Save your work and select Activate.

checklist item Select these org and app defaults.

  • Org and App Defaults: Don’t set this page as the org or app default.
  • Select Apps: Health Cloud - Lightning Console.
  • Selected Record Types: Person Account, Account, and any other record types you’ve configured using the Individual Record Type Mapper.
  • Selected Profiles: Any profiles that need access to the page.

Create Optional Lightning Pages

The Patient Console record page is required for the Health Cloud console. Other pages are optional and can be created and added as needed. Follow the steps to create the Patient Console page and use the information listed in this table for each page you want to add.

Lightning Page Label Page Layout Component Name
Patients Patients One Column Patient List View for Health Cloud
Today Today Main Column and Right Sidebar (for Chatter) Today View for Health Cloud

Create Health Cloud Lightning Admin App

Create the Lightning app that lets you and your admins set up and customize the console.

checklist item Use the App Manager to create a Lightning app and name it Health Cloud Lightning Admin.

checklist item Set the app’s primary color, give it a logo, and add a description.

checklist item Select the Standard Navigation option.

checklist item Add items to your app’s utility bar and select the items you want to appear in the app. This should include all EHR objects and other items, as required. Assign it to user profiles and save your work.
